쉘 스크립트 질문입니다.
글쓴이: 하하 / 작성시간: 월, 2005/09/05 - 5:09오후
#!/bin/sh echo "ZZZZ " echo "RRRR " echo "CCCC " echo "BBBBB "| grep ZZZZ
위 출력 결과를 ZZZZ 로 만들고 싶습니다.
스크립트라 한줄씩 출력이 되어서 grep 에서 ZZZZ를
못 찾는거 같습니다.
아래와 같이 해도 안되네요??
무슨 좋은 방법 없을까요? 긴 줄이라 여러줄에 걸쳐
보여줘야 할 필요가 있습니다.
echo "ZZZZ RRRR CCCC BBBB " | grep ZZZZ
Forums:
[code:1]#!/bin/shTEST="AAAA&quo
이렇게 하니까 되네요
[code:1]TEST="AAAA"TEST=&#
이러면 안되네요??
쉘 변수의.. 길이가 정해져 잇나봐요??
“바람에게도 길은 있다. 나는 비로소 나의 길을 가느니. 길은 언제나 어디에나 있다.”
[quote="하하"][code:1]TEST="AAAA&qu
쉘 변수의 길이가 문제가 아니라 공백의 문제 입니다.
방법을 찾아 보고 글 올리도록 하겠습니다.
[code:1]$ cat test.sh# 1echo "a
그냥 개행문자(LF)가 포함된 여러 라인을 출력해버리면 되는 거 아닌가요?
----
http://nohmad.tumblr.com/
()를 활용하세요.
위와 같이 하시면 될 것 같네요.
댓글 달기